In this week’s episode, Scott interviews Pastor Prodip Das, a Bengali church planter in New York City with ABWE’s EveryEthne ministry. Together, they discuss the unique nature and conflict of Christianity and Islam within Bangladesh.

Prodip tells his personal testimony and what it is like growing up in a Christian family in the country. Prodip also talks about his ministry within New York City and discipling Muslim-background believers.

Key Topics

  • The history of ABWE ministry in Bangladesh
  • Prodip’s personal testimony of growing up a Christian in Bangladesh
  • The nature of persecution of Muslim-background believers in Bangladesh
  • Prodip’s church planting ministry in New York City
